Kreia’s Contradiction: Wouldn’t destroying the Force be considered counterintuitive? by Loopers84 in kotor

[–]kaleb314 0 points1 point  (0 children)

She considers the endless conflicts of the Jedi and Sith to be ultimately non-productive. The same conflicts play out and repeat, no one learns their lesson for more than a couple generations, the Jedi do nothing and the Sith destroy. She’s not naive enough to believe that removing the Force from the equation will end conflict, she believes that it will remove the stagnating factors from the equation and free people from one source of invisible control over their lives.

But Kreia’s motives and goals can be difficult to grasp. Most villains have one big goal that they pursue for one or two main motives. Kreia has a whole bunch of broad ideological motives, at least two main goals, and the way that the Exile plays into these goals for her is kind of contradictory. On top of that, she’ll also say or do just about anything if she believes it will serve a purpose to her goals or teach you a lesson. She isn’t really a Sith Lord, not anymore, but she re-dons the mantle of Darth Traya in the endgame in order to force the final conflict between her and the Exile. She considers the Sith to be ultimately self-destructive and worse than the Jedi, whose worst sin in her eyes is preachy dead-end dogma that inhibits growth and action. The Sith are more or less a lost cause, she’s verbally savage with the Jedi because she believes there could be some hope for them if they were willing to listen.
Kreia values:
1. Free will (almost above all else)
2. Personal growth
3. Pragmatic self-interest
4. Perspective informed by multiple viewpoints, especially those outside of conventional dogma (the Jedi teachings vs. the Sith teachings vs. her own teachings vs. the Exile’s unique life outside the Force)

And her two main goals that she works towards:
1. Proving that there is value to her teachings by cultivating her ideal student, the Exile.
2. Deafening the galaxy to the Force, freeing it from the Force’s influence.

And in the middle all of this is Kreia’s attachment to the Exile. Regardless of the outcome of her plans, her scheming and manipulating, Kreia considers the Exile’s existence to be beautiful, and she craves their attention, engagement, and understanding. The way this all works out in the end changes with the rebuilt Enclave’s “branching point” in the story. With more dev time it probably could’ve been more complex, but in the finished and restored game it comes down to:

A: The LS path Exile is a person capable of some degree of listening, some potential receptivity to Kreia’s teachings. After the Jedi Masters refuse to see the value in the Exile’s experience outside the Force and the Exile has confronted their past, Kreia is ready to move to the final stage of her plans involving Malachor. Either the Exile defeats her and lives on in proof that her teachings and the Exile’s experience do have value to them, or Kreia and the Exile both die, the wounds in the Force echo in on each other, and the whole galaxy is eventually deafened to the Force as a result. In either case, Kreia achieves one of her ultimate goals and thus can consider herself successful. Despite that, the Exile’s victory is her strong preference here. I believe that though she planned on the possibility, she does not believe that the Exile will not or should not defeat her. “I would have killed the galaxy to preserve you. You are more precious than you know; what you have taught yourself cannot be allowed to die.”

B: The DS path Exile proves to ultimately be no different than the Sith and is no worthy example of what Kreia believes in. The Exile kills the Jedi, rejects Kreia’s teachings, and no longer serves any purpose to Kreia outside deafening the galaxy to the Force. Kreia goes to Malachor with the exclusive intent of killing the Exile in their final battle. “You have failed me. Completely and utterly.”

[DESPISED Trope] You need a SECRET to proceed to the main ending by Liquid_Pestar in TopCharacterTropes

[–]kaleb314 1 point2 points  (0 children)

This whole game was built out of this shit. Warn the students by social media or else you’ll get locked into a bad ending later on. Find Jessica or whatever’s corpse in a locker or else you’ll get locked into a bad ending later on. Take the pills from the creepy itchy guy or else you’ll suddenly die of blood poisoning later on. Granted, it is by design what they were going for, they were trying to do a Clock Tower 1 ending flowchart sort of thing, but that doesn’t make it good. Certainly not in this execution. If the bad endings you got from these “failure” paths were interesting it wouldn’t be so bad, but it’s almost all either abrupt game overs or one of like three constantly recycled endings. So instead you just replay the same bits of the game over and over seeing the same things over and over getting the same endings over and over until you finally go through and do all the missable things you need to do to get on the flowchart path to the actual ending of the game.
It feels like the vast majority of Clock Tower successors are just unfathomably cursed to fail, but Night Cry is by far the worst of them. And it was made by a star studded team of industry professionals, many of whom had previously worked on Clock Tower. It even had the Castlevania SotN composer if I remember correctly, which is baffling to me since I don’t recall much if any music other than maybe a background piano piece in the ball room at the beginning, maybe some generic scare stings for cutscenes like DmC Donte getting eaten by the vending machine? Otherwise nothing but a constant low environmental hum that plays whenever Scissor Walker is on the prowl for 99% of the game.
